2 Claims. (Cl. 49--92) 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A louvered damper for controlling gaseous flow having a plurality of parallel louver blades mounted within a rectangular frame by a central shaft. On one side of the shaft, each blade has a rigid blade profile; and on the other side of the shaft, each blade has a resilient blade profile. An adjusting mechanism is provided to actuate the blades between an open position through a closed position to a closed limit position. In the closed limit position, the resilient profile of each blade is deformed to conform to the contour of the rigid profile of an adjoining blade to form a tight seal along the marginal overlap between the blades to cut off the gaseous flow.
The present invention relates to an improvement in louvered dampers consisting of a rectangular frame and a number of damper blades arranged in the frame, so that in closed position the blades somewhat overlap each other, each of said damper blades being provided with a central shaft journalled in the side elements of the frame and an adjusting mechanism actuating the damper blades.
In prior dampers of the above-mentioned kind it has been diflicult to get an effective cut-off of the passing air flow because of the difficulties in making the damper blades and the adjusting mechanism with such precision that all the damper blades in closed position contact each other in sealing engagement.
The present invention, which intends to eliminate said drawbacks with simple means, is characterized in that each damper blade on one side of the shaft has a rigid blade profile and on the opposite side a resilient blade profile and that the adjusting mechanism is made to turn the damper shafts somewhat beyond the normal closing position to a closed limit position in which the rigid blade profile deforms the adjacent overlapping resilient blade profile and effects a tight seal along the marginal overlap.

The lever 5b is attached to the shaft 4 and transfers the longitudinal motion of the bar 5a to a rotating motion, illustrated in FIG. 2 and FIG. 3 with broken-line arcs. Each one of the damper blades has a rigid blade profile 3a on one side of the shaft and on the opposite side a resilient blade profile 3b. To obtain with a large marginal sealing engagement between the separate damper blades and between the uppermost blade and the flange 7, the adjusting mechanism is, in accordance with the invention, made to turn the damper shafts somewhat beyond the normal closing position to a closed limit position. This is especially shown in FIG. 3, which shows that the rigid profile of one blade is positioned to deform or flex the resilient profile of the adjacent overlapping blade.

What I claim is:
1. A louvered damper for controlling a gaseous flow comprising a frame having side elements, a plurality of louver blades each having a shaft journalled in the side elements of said frame for mounting said blades in said frame, and an adjusting mechanism to actuate said blades between an open position affording flow therethrough and a closed position wherein. said blades are in marginal overlapping relation, the improvement wherein each blade comprises a resilient blade profile on one side of said shaft and a rigid blade profile on the opposite side of said shaft and connecting means interconnecting said blades with said adjusting mechanism operable to displace said blades beyond said closed position to a closed limit position wherein the rigid blade profile of one blade engages against the resilient blade profile of the adjacent overlapping blade to deform the same to effect a tight seal along the marginal overlap.
2. A louvered damper according to claim 1, wherein said frame is rectangular and includes a flange adapted to overlap the end blade and flex the resilient profile thereof when in said closed position.
